Simple salmon with spring pasta

Asparagus, peas and broad beans are all natural partners for fish, make them more indulgent with creamy tarragon pasta

Ingredients

2 serv.
  • drizzle of olive oil
  • salmon fillets2

    skin removed

  • slices prosciutto2
  • asparagus200g g

    trimmed and cut into short lengths

  • pasta150g g

    (we used dried egg pasta)

  • mixed peas and podded broad bean175g g

    (frozen is fine)

  • mascarpone5 tbsp tbsp
  • zest and juice ½ lemon

    the rest cut into wedges

  • small bunch tarragon

    roughly chopped

Step-by-step instructions

  1. 1

    Heat oven to 220C/200C fan/gas 7. Rub the oil over the bottom of a large roasting tin or baking dish. Season the salmon with black pepper and a little salt, then wrap a piece of prosciutto around the middle of each fillet. Roast for 10 mins, then toss the asparagus into the oily tin and roast for 5 mins more.

  2. 2

    Meanwhile, boil the pasta following pack instructions, adding the peas and beans 2 mins before the end of cooking. Once the vegetables and pasta are just tender, reserve a cup of the cooking water, then drain.

  3. 3

    Remove the salmon from the tin, then add the mascarpone, pasta, 3 tbsp of the cooking water, the lemon zest and juice, and tarragon. Season to taste and toss until the pasta is covered with creamy sauce. Serve with the fish and a lemon wedge.
